Service Accounts — TumbleLock Access Flow. The Rinsewell laundry-locker service uses a dedicated service account to issue short-lived unlock tokens. Tokens are scoped to a single locker bank, expire after 90 seconds, and every issuance is written to the audit ledger. No residential user credentials transit this path. The staging issuer accepts requests authenticated with the key below.

app token of yajeg-kawef = kto11_7En3XSX8xQw

Effective Monday, the Brightmoor Analytics mail room relocates from the ground-floor annex to Suite 14 beside the loading dock. Night shift staff accepting courier deliveries after 22:00 must escort drivers directly to the new suite, verify parcel counts against the manifest, and secure the roller shutter before leaving. The old annex door will be decommissioned on Friday. Until then, access to Suite 14 is granted using the code below.

staff pass of kawep-hahap = bdg-IEUUF-6

Finance Review Summary — Q3

The Meridial Systems division remains under hiring freeze. Backfills require CFO sign-off; no exceptions granted this quarter. Payroll run-rate is down 4% since the freeze began. Contractor spend crept up in the Valport office and will be capped next cycle. Department heads should resubmit headcount requests only after the November review. The freeze's duration depends on decisions summarized in the confidential note below.

management briefing: Istaelix Group is in early talks to buy Sorysax Logistics for about $496.2 million. The Kasox launch date is October 3, and nothing goes to the press before then. Legal wants the Norokax Foods term sheet withdrawn before April 25.

**Q: What happens to my local credentials when we migrate to the Hermitage hermetic build system?**

A: Hermitage builds run in sealed sandboxes, so nothing from your home directory is visible to build actions. Caches are keyed by content hashes, which means your first build after migration will be slow — that's expected. Secrets are fetched through the sealed broker instead of environment variables. To initialize your broker session for the first time, enter the passphrase below.

recovery phrase for bawep-kawef: oliath-casdor